@ParametersAreNonnullByDefault
See: Description
| Class | Description |
|---|---|
| AwsCredentialsProperties |
Properties related to AWS credentials for Genie on top of what Spring Cloud AWS provides.
|
| AwsCredentialsProperties.SpringCloudAwsRegionProperties |
Property bindings for Spring Cloud AWS region specific properties.
|
| ClusterCheckerProperties |
Properties associated with the cluster checking task.
|
| DatabaseCleanupProperties |
Properties controlling the behavior of the database cleanup leadership task.
|
| DataServiceRetryProperties |
All properties related to data service retry template in Genie.
|
| DiskCleanupProperties |
Properties controlling the behavior of the database cleanup leadership task.
|
| ExponentialBackOffTriggerProperties |
Properties to configure an ExponentialBackOffTrigger.
|
| FileCacheProperties |
Properties related to the Genie file cache.
|
| GRpcServerProperties |
Properties related to Genie's gRPC server functionality.
|
| HealthProperties |
All properties related to health thresholds in Genie.
|
| HttpProperties |
Properties related to HTTP client configuration.
|
| HttpProperties.Connect |
Connection related properties for HTTP requests.
|
| HttpProperties.Read |
Read related properties for HTTP requests.
|
| JobFileSyncRpcProperties |
Properties for configuring the job file sync processes.
|
| JobsCleanupProperties |
Properties related to cleanup for jobs.
|
| JobsForwardingProperties |
Properties related to job forwarding.
|
| JobsLocationsProperties |
Properties for various job related locations.
|
| JobsMaxProperties |
Properties related to maximum values allowed for various components of running jobs.
|
| JobsMemoryProperties |
Properties pertaining to how much memory jobs can use on Genie.
|
| JobsProperties |
All properties related to jobs in Genie.
|
| JobsUsersActiveLimitProperties |
Properties related to user limits in number of active jobs.
|
| JobsUsersProperties |
Properties related to users running jobs.
|
| LeadershipProperties |
Properties related to static leadership election configurations.
|
| MailProperties |
Properties related to email notifications from Genie to users.
|
| RetryProperties |
All properties related to Http retry template in Genie.
|
| RetryProperties.S3RetryProperties |
Retry properties related to S3.
|
| S3FileTransferProperties |
Properties for S3FileTransfer.
|
| ScriptLoadBalancerProperties |
Properties related to the
ScriptLoadBalancer
implementation. |
| SwaggerProperties |
Properties related to Genie and swagger.
|
| TasksExecutorPoolProperties |
Properties related to the thread pool for the task executor within Genie.
|
| TasksSchedulerPoolProperties |
Properties related to the thread pool for the task executor within Genie.
|
| ZookeeperLeadershipProperties |
Properties related to Zookeeper.
|